Walk into KINK Bar and Boutique in Cape Town’s easygoing and vibey Park Road and your senses will be immediately ignited.
Here, nothing is bland. Rich, elegant, inviting colours work together with alluring textures, materials and thoughtful touches (think feathers, roses and striking lampshades) to create a space that is elegant yet unpretentious, grown-up yet fun and, mostly, all kinds of kinky…
A theatre of erotic circus, filled with delights, delicacies and all that is delectable… this is KINK Bar and Boutique, the newest tease in town. Sip on a seductive cocktail, snack on a heavenly platter, and then get the party started!
“Every night at KINK is like going into an Alice in Wonderland story and getting lost down a rabbit hole,” says co-owner Gia Pra-Levis, who was extensively involved with event management all over Europe before moving to Cape Town.
A quick look at the party line-up at KINK and it’s clear that Gia is putting her events experience into good practice. Don’t expect mainstream for the masses though – KINK is a creative platform for performers and DJs to conjure up a sensational cross-genre party experience they usually aren’t at liberty to do elsewhere.
Tuesdays are Tango nights at KINK, dance the night away to traditional tango, electro tango and any other figure hugging sensual tango beats and twist
Wednesday's are Lip Sync at KINK - Think Disco, think mirror ball, think afro and an all round bad decade for fashion.
Thursdays are Profile - 101 and Vintage nights at KINK, featuring Cape Town's finest mixologists.
Eccentric Fridays involve exploring musical genius, ranging from the playful to the absurd, and a mishmash of magical musical madness.
Saturday nights are Stripped nights at KINK, with minimal, experimental, deep and dirty beats with Resident DJ Charles Large.

There aren’t enough venues in the Western Cape that cater for the more discerning music-lover,” laments Gia. She’s aiming to ensure that KINK is exactly the kind of place where connoisseurs of magic music can feel right at home.
From the décor to the dance floor, KINK is about all things sensual, and that most definitely includes food and drink...
On offer are an enticing selection of delectable platters with names like Slippery Selection, Lovers' Delight, Soft & Sensitive and Smack Your Lips, and ingredients like cherry tomatoes, apricots, granadillas, prosciutto ham, chorizo sausage and Gruyère and brie cheeses.
Now, moving onto delights more liquid in nature: KINK cocktails! Of course, anything ordinary would be awkwardly out of place here.
Cast a loving gaze over the cocktail menu and ponder to yourself: “Should I go for a Dirty Sanchez, or a Slap & Tickle, a Spank The Skank, a Large One or perhaps an Anonymous Fondle?” KINK has put much effort into concocting a selection of cocktails that are as erotic as they are exotic.
Two upstairs rooms at KINK house a sexy boutique, where you’ll find all sorts of naughty numbers.
The boutique has the same opening hours as the downstairs area, so you’re free to wander up and find that perfect something to show off to your special someone downstairs. “It’s amazing how many people buy a whip at 1 in the morning!” laughs Gia.
“Everything at KINK has a twist; we want you to laugh out loud and go ‘ooh!’”, smiles Gia. Come in for a sexy cocktail, start tapping your feet and then dance till 2am. You never know what’s going to happen at KINK!
